传统的有线传输方式在布线时有可能经过的环境非常复杂,例如,高温、腐蚀、摩损等情况,这时实施布线就相当麻烦。所以,可以将一部分布线实现无线化,这样就极大的提高布线的灵活性,从而可以轻松应付多种复杂环境。因为在实际的布线应用中,RS485总线搭配Modbus协议这种布网方式非常流行,所以本文便提出一种基于Modbus协议的RS485无线布线方案。本文首先会对本文所涉及的一些概念作详细解释和对无线布线系统进行功能需求的分析。其次会给出无线布线系统的硬件实现方案,硬件方案中会包括主控芯片和射频芯片相关功能的具体说明和芯片之间的连接电路图。再次会给出可行的软件实现方案,在软件方案中会详细介绍有线数据的收发和无线数据的收发功能实现方法,主控芯片MSP430F149、射频芯片CC2420和RS485接口芯片MAX485的工作原理及它们的操控方法。最后为了操控和测试本系统,还和给出PC端软件实现方案和一些必要的测试数据。